Sonnet VIII

This man is apparently sad while listening to music, and at first we don't know why. The fact that he is not married annoys him, and the beautiful harmonies in music remind him of this, as he is also reminded that he is still single. Each string being played in a music, representing a father, mother a child, play together in harmony, and are happy. He is not married, he is alone, and he feels worthless in this very fact.

Masquerade

A Masquerade is an easy place for individuals to meet new people, or even converse with people they would not have spoken with otherwise, had they known their identity. Men returning from war could most likely meet young ladies they'd like to court and "make babies with" with these masks acting like a shield, giving them more confidence in the matter. There a freedom present in this kind of party where anyone masked could do as they please, even lie and deceive.
